web terminal

This commit is contained in:
Usman Nasir
2019-11-02 19:29:02 +05:00
parent dd21a17b41
commit 087322f2b4
58 changed files with 16489 additions and 3141 deletions

4
mailServer/mailserverManager.py Normal file → Executable file
View File

@@ -356,7 +356,7 @@ class MailServerManager:
## Delete Email PIPE
sourceusername = source.split("@")[0]
virtualalias = '%s %salias' % (source, sourceusername)
pipealias = '%salias:  "|%s"' % (sourceusername, destination)
pipealias = '%salias: "|%s"' % (sourceusername, destination)
command = "sed -i 's/^" + source + ".*//g' /etc/postfix/virtual"
ProcessUtilities.executioner(command)
command = "sed -i 's/^" + sourceusername + ".*//g' /etc/aliases"
@@ -429,7 +429,7 @@ class MailServerManager:
ProcessUtilities.executioner(command)
## examplealias: "|/usr/bin/php -q /home/domain.com/public_html/ticket/api/pipe.php"
pipealias = '%salias:  "|%s"' % (sourceusername, destination)
pipealias = '%salias: "|%s"' % (sourceusername, destination)
command = "echo '" + pipealias + "' >> /etc/aliases"
ProcessUtilities.executioner(command)